Technical Field
The utility model relates to a lamps and lanterns field, in particular to ceiling light.
Background
The LED ceiling lamp is embedded in a ceiling and emits light downwards, the interior of architectural decoration is hidden by using a light source, the LED light source is not exposed and does not irritate eye skin, so that the overall unity and perfection of the architectural decoration can be kept, and the LED ceiling lamp is widely applied to illumination of hotels, western-style restaurants, coffee shops, offices, markets, professional show windows and the like. The LED used for the LED ceiling lamp is used as a light source, and has the characteristics of no mercury, no toxicity, no electromagnetic pollution, no harmful rays, energy conservation, environmental protection, long service life and the like.
However, the existing LED ceiling lamp has a simple structure, and the connection structure is not very stable and is easy to disassemble; moreover, the existing LED ceiling lamp easily collides with the housing when adjusting the angle, thereby affecting the appearance of the lamp body.

Examples
Referring to fig. 1-5, a ceiling lamp comprises a heat sink 1, a power cover 2 is connected to the bottom of the heat sink 1 in a clamped manner, an inner clip 6 is arranged on the inner side of the heat sink 1, a support 5 is fixedly arranged on the inner side of the inner clip 6, a lamp bead 4 is fixedly arranged on the inner side of the support 5, a lens 8 is arranged right above the support 5 at the upper end of the inner side of the inner clip 6, a middle ring 9 is arranged at the upper end of the outer side of the inner clip 6 in a clamped manner, the middle ring 9 is connected to the inner side of the inner clip 6 in a clamped manner, an outer ring 11 is arranged on the outer side of the top of the heat sink 1, a positioning structure 14 is fixedly connected to the inner side of the outer ring 11, a stop boss 13 is fixedly connected to the outer side of the heat sink 1, the stop boss 13 is arranged inside the positioning structure 14, and the middle ring 9 can be connected with the inner clip 6 in a clamped manner by matching with the second reverse buckle 10, thereby fix lens 8 between interior card 6 and zhong hua 9, through first back-off 7 and back-off draw-in groove 12, can be with interior card 6 joint in the inboard of radiator 1, the connection of above structure is comparatively stable, can not dismantled by bare-handed, through setting up only to boss 13 and location structure 14, connect in first screw hole 15 and second screw hole 16 by connecting bolt 17, make only to boss 13 rotate in the inside of location structure 14, it is provided with a arch to only the top of boss 13, can with the inslot looks joint in the location structure 14, thereby prevent that radiator 1 from colliding with the corner of outer loop 11, make this ceiling light can not influence beautifully.
Referring to fig. 1, for the purpose of making the light condensing effect of the lamp bead 4 better; the bottom of the inner card 6 is provided with the reflective paper 3, and the inner card 6 clamps the reflective paper 3 under the lamp beads 4; through setting up reflection of light paper 3, can play the effect of spotlight to lamp pearl 4.
Referring to fig. 1-2, for the purpose of facilitating more stable connection of the components; the outer side surface of the middle ring 9 is fixedly connected with a second reverse buckle 10, the middle ring 9 is clamped with the inner clamp 6 through the second reverse buckle 10, the outer side surface of the inner clamp 6 is fixedly connected with a first reverse buckle 7, the inner side of the radiator 1 is provided with a reverse buckle clamping groove 12, the first reverse buckle 7 is clamped in the reverse buckle clamping groove 12, the number of the first reverse buckles 7 is four, and the number of the second reverse buckles 10 is four; through setting up second back-off 10, be convenient for carry out the joint with zhonghuan 9 and interior card 6, fix lens 8 between zhonghuan 9 and interior card 6, through setting up first back-off 7 and back-off draw-in groove 12, can be with the inboard of interior card 6 joint at radiator 1, through setting up four first back-offs 7 and second back-off 10 for the joint is more stable.
Referring to fig. 3-4, for the purpose of mounting the heat sink 1 inside the outer ring 11; a first threaded hole 15 is formed in the surface of the stopping boss 13, a second threaded hole 16 is formed in the surface of the outer ring 11, a connecting bolt 17 is connected to the inner thread of the second threaded hole 16 in a threaded manner, and the connecting bolt 17 penetrates through the second threaded hole 16 and is connected into the first threaded hole 15 in a threaded manner; by providing the first and second threaded holes 15, 16 and the connecting bolts 17, the stop bosses 13 can be mounted on the inside of the positioning structure 14, so that the heat sink 1 is mounted on the inside of the outer ring 11.
Referring to fig. 1 and 5, for the purpose of protecting the lens 8; the lower end of the inner side of the inner card 6 is fixedly connected with a clamping pin 18, and the lower end of the middle ring 9 is attached and connected with the clamping pin 18; by arranging the clamping feet 18, a better protection effect can be achieved on the lens 8.
